As a global ban looms over a popular Chinese app, a framed expatriate cyber expert races to clear his name and expose a conspiracy threatening democracy worldwide.
1977
2007
1945
1974
2022
1971
1972
1970
2002
1975
1965
1964
2006
2008
1995
2003